Hungary launches Stipendium Hungaricum scholarship programme
Baku, February 13, AZERTAC
The Government of Hungary has launched the Stipendium Hungaricum scholarship programme for the academic year 2017/2018, in which frame 200 Azerbaijani students can study in Hungary. The scholarship will cover the following provisions: exemption from the payment of tuition fee, a monthly stipend according to the relevant Hungarian legislation, dormitory place, or a monthly contribution of HUF 40.000 to accommodation costs for the whole duration of the scholarship period and health care services according to the relevant Hungarian legislation and supplementary medical insurance.
Applicants can submit applications only online on the website: http://www.tka.hu/international-programmes/2966/stipendium-hungaricum/, till 5th of March 2017. Please note, that in the programme only those students or applicants can take part, whose applications are supported by the Ministry of Education of the Republic of Azerbaijan, as an Eligible Sending Partner. So the applicants have to submit the applications online to the ministry on the same time.
The applicants can find detailed information about the process, deadlines and the necessary documents on the websites: http://www.tka.hu/international-programmes/2966/stipendium-hungaricum/ and http://edu.gov.az/upload/file/ELAN/2017/Yanvar/macaristan_elan.pdf.
